Manual 4 Point
Manual 4 PointFigure 7-27:
a. Position the laser and sensor at a starting angle (ideally at the first cardinal
position, 0°).
The laser and sensor angles should be within 2° of each other and within 3° of the
active cardinal position (0°, 90°, 180°, and 270°), if possible. When this happens,
the background of the box displayed below the machine is green. If the laser and
sensor angles are not within 2° of each other and 3° of the active cardinal
position, the box background is white.
b. Rotate the laser fixtures a full revolution stopping at each cardinal position (0°,
90°, 180°, and 270°). Press F3 Accept Readings after stopping at each point.
Note
While it is always desirable to measure at all four cardinal positions, it is possible to
estimate an alignment solution with only three measurements.
The status LED on the analyzer flashes and an audible tone is produced whenever
a reading is taken. The audible tone is only available when the Status Beeper on
the General Setup screen is set to On
.
c. After taking readings for each of the cardinal position, press Enter.
